Under $25,000 health insurance coverage rates in Fort Collins, Colorado compared
How does Fort Collins, Colorado compare to other Colorado and National averages?
Fort Collins, Colorado
97.9%
Colorado
93.3% (-5% lower than Fort Collins, Colorado)
National average
89% (-9% lower than Fort Collins, Colorado)

Historical Timeline
97.9% of households earning under 25,000 in Fort Collins, Colorado have health insurance historical data
2015 - 94.5%
The 2015 94.5% is the baseline measurement.
2016 - 93%
The 2016 decrease to 93% from 2015 represents a -1.5% decrease YoY.
2017 - 92.6%
The 2017 decrease to 92.6% from 2016 represents a -0.4% decrease YoY.
2018 - 90.1%
The 2018 decrease to 90.1% from 2017 represents a -2.5% decrease YoY.
2019 - 90.6%
The 2019 increase to 90.6% from 2018 represents a 0.5% increase YoY.
2021 - 92.8%
The 2021 increase to 92.8% from 2019 represents a 2.2% increase YoY.
2022 - 93.3%
The 2022 increase to 93.3% from 2021 represents a 0.5% increase YoY.
2023 - 97.9%
The 2023 increase to 97.9% from 2022 represents a 4.6% increase YoY.
